Default 5.1 Output via 888 SPDIF out?

Does anyone know if it is possible to have ProTools playback 6 individual audio tracks via the single SPDIF output on an 888 Audio Interface which is hooked up to a decoder?

Nope - 5.1 track must be routed in I/O setup and it forces you to select 6 individual outputs. Plus - SPDIF only comes in and goes out via channels 1-2. Good Idea tho....
